Pro-Kremlin Youth Group's Brochure Exposes Rabidly Paranoid Worldview

A brochure put out by the pro-Kremlin youth group "Nashi" exposes the movement's rabidly paranoid worldview. The author of the brochure employs an extremely broad use of the word "fascist" to describe extremist nationalists, far-left opponents of the Kremlin's policies, and pro-Western liberals, characterizing all of them as part of an enormous conspiracy against Russia. What the brochure does not mention is that the same sponsors of "Nashi" in the Kremlin have in recent years entered into a de facto alliance with extremist nationalist groups, and that the nationalist demonstration pictured in the brochure was granted official sanction by the Moscow city authorities, who violently disrupted last month's peaceful opposition rally by Gary Kasparov's "Other Russia."
